Please indicate your faculty and program, your current year and expected graduation date, and include the confirmation of eligibility when applying.*** Hiring Unit: Humanities and Social Sciences Library Number of openings: 3 Hourly rate: $16.70 Duration: 13 weeks Position Summary: Under the direction of a library staff member, the student assists with the delivery of Library services during peak periods. Duties include circulating materials of various formats, answering basic inquiries from users, and contributing to the processing and organizing of library materials. Must be available on weekends. Must be available to work the same hours every week. May be required to open and/or close the service desk and perform emergency evacuation procedures. May be required to walk between buildings. Performs other supplementary tasks as assigned. Other Qualifying Skills and/or Abilities Demonstrated organizational skills, attention to detail, and ability to clearly transmit and receive information. Must be user-focused and service-oriented. Demonstrated ability to cope with physical requirements: handling, carrying and lifting of library materials. Previous library or similar experience preferred. English: spoken, read and written.
